This document discusses precision medicine and its future applications. It notes that currently many patients do not respond to initial treatments for common conditions like depression, asthma, diabetes and Alzheimer's. Precision medicine aims to change this by using massive datasets including genomics, clinical information, and population data to better understand disease at the individual level and tailor diagnosis and treatment specifically for each patient. This more personalized approach could help get the right treatment to patients more quickly and effectively.
